Полноэкранный вариант в плеере Chromeless с использованием Javascript?
Я использую JavaScript Javascript API для разработки Chromeless Player. Можете ли вы сказать мне, как добавить / разработать "Полноэкранный контроль", используя Javascript на плеере?
1 ответ
Решение
Это не то, что в настоящее время существует в API YouTube. Вместо этого вы можете использовать полноэкранный API javascript для обеспечения функциональности. Подробности можно найти на MDN здесь.
https://developer.mozilla.org/en-US/docs/DOM/Using_fullscreen_mode
Пример кода будет выглядеть примерно так
var player = new YT.player('#my-video');
// Once the user clicks a custom fullscreen button
var el = document.getElementById('#my-player-element-container');
if (el.requestFullScreen) {
el.requestFullScreen();
} else if (el.mozRequestFullScreen) {
el.mozRequestFullScreen();
} else if (el.webkitRequestFullScreen) {
el.webkitRequestFullScreen();
}